Transaction 6ebcb8371e87577d4f32662b50cacf60fa0a770127875765733a584c1d381d75
1 Input
1 Output
-
6ebcb8371e87577d4f32662b50cacf60fa0a770127875765733a584c1d381d75:0
- value
- 758923
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ba8d0f10e65dea8952f8ec383e4c1650f677bea5
- address
- bc1qh2xs7y8xth4gj5hcasurunqk2rm8004990yd7h